This has no real effect on the abilities of the crewmen. >>> Invest Order Invest: IN Corporation, Shares# -- With this order, you enter the Corporation code, which is a three-letter designator or the company you want to invest in, and the number of Shares# for the transaction. Use a plus sign (+) to purchase shares, and a minus sign (-) to sell shares. So the order IN ATM +100 would allow you to purchase 100 shares of ATM stock. You may own up to 25,000 shares in each corporation, and they can be bought or sold anywhere in the galaxy at any time. Each 100 shares of stock in a company you are aligned with is worth 1 vote. You will not make any money from a stock until you sell your shares back to the stock market, at which time your profits or losses will be collected. Also, you'll have to pay a 5% fee to your broker when selling stock certificates. You may purchase or sell up to a maximum of 25,000 shares per transaction. Stock prices fluctuate on the open market along with the standard economic indicators. See the Economic Page in the latest Galactic Inquirer for economic details and stock values. >>> Improve Skill Order Improve Skill: IS Skill1... Skill3 -- Works the same except that you can train in up to 3 skills at a time. >>> Jump Order Jump: JU Dir# Dir#... Dir# -- To get from here to there, you use this order. Different ships have different drives... some faster, some slower. Dir# is a direction number as shown on your Map Of The Core, and it indicates a 1-quad jump in that direction. You can enter as many jumps as your drive is capable of handling in a single order, and you can use multiple jump orders for long distance travel. For example, the order for a level 2 jumpdrive, JU 7778, means jump 3 quads in direction 7 and one quad in direction 8. Slow drives can only jump 2 quads, while Imperial Navy ships can jump up to 12 quads, which is the hyperjump limit for space travel. A single jump uses up one unit of Nukonium Petrolex fuel, no matter how far the distance is. Valid direction numbers are 1 through 8. You may end your jump anywhere on the map, including deep space. Use 0 as the Dir# to dock your ship on a planet or outpost. When you dock your ship, the computer takes control, contacting the local authorities and landing your ship at a planet's capital city (city #1) or an outpost's docking bay. Whenever you dock, your Bigelow's Guide will give a listing of all cities, available services and special orders available, and this information should be recorded in your Exploration Log. Once on-world, you must go through the usual Customs inspections to receive your docking papers. Your ship might get scanned for illegal cargo, depending on the empire and underworld levels, and confiscation is possible. To avoid customs altogether, you can try a forced landing by using 9 as the Dir#, but only on planets. Forced landings are dangerous, and failure might result in a crash landing, so beware! Using 0 or 9 to dock does not count as a jump and uses no extra fuel. So, a ship with a level 1 jumpdrive could use the order JU 330 to move 2 Quads in direction 3 and then dock, expending 1 unit of fuel. Once landed, you are free to shop the bazaars, check out local taverns, enjoy the hospitality of the native inhabitants, and buy or sell items where available. You can also use the public city transfer system (CT) to travel to other cities on the world. System3 -- Works the same except that you can repair up to 3 systems at a time. >>> Vote Order Vote: VO Decision -- Responsibility comes to those who align with a corporation. There will be times when major policy decisions will require a vote from all corporate members, and these resolutions can alter your future and fortune forever! The number of votes you get is your ship level squared, so a level one ship gets 1 vote, but a level 4 ship gets 16. You also get 1 vote per 100 shares of stock you own in the same corporation you are aligned with. Your strength and power in your corporation are directly related to your own worth and influence. Whenever a vote is proposed, it will be published in The Galactic Inquirer. Once published, all corporate members may cast a vote Decision of AYE or NAY. A non-vote is automatically cast as a NAY, and if you vote more than once, only your last vote is tallied. This allows you to change your mind later in the month. All proposed votes are placed on ballot by the 7 intergalactic mega-corporations. >>> The Standings Lists The following players have earned a place of exceptional honor and respect by competing and succeeding as first-class Smugglers.
